OK... Thanks for all the input... Here is what I found so far. Front Tire was 5 pounds over pressure. Tire says 40psi max and it was 45 psi. reduced it to 39psi and took it on the road. Got up to 90 and still felt good. BUT... it was only a short stretch. I have an appointment with the dealer today at 9am so I will ask them to look at it further.

Springers are noted to have neckbearing issues,thats why you need to re-seat after 5,000 miles and replace 10-15 thou and if you ride hard or not so nice roads the neck bearings go out faster....And thats no bull...This is why I didn't buy a Heritage Springer when they came out and what has kept me from adding a Cross Bones to my collection......
